What is the difference between bulk property detectors and
Solute property detectors vivimed labs limited
Answer Posted / guest
Bulk property detectors as the name suggest depends on bulk
material i.e. solvent e.g. RI detector. Whereas solute
property detectors depend on solute such as UV-Vis detector.
